Rebuilding Together Miami-Dade
Rebuilding Together Miami-Dade is a nonprofit organization dedicated to empowering low-income, vulnerable homeowners, small business owners, and community organizations through critical home repair and accessibility modifications. The organization aims to create safe, accessible homes and thriving community spaces in Miami-Dade County.
Mission and Activities
Rebuilding Together Miami-Dade has been serving Miami-Dade County for over 30 years. The organization's mission is to make the community safer, healthier, and more affordable one home at a time. They provide home repairs and modifications at no cost to qualified recipients, focusing on enhancing safety, accessibility, and the overall quality of life for vulnerable residents.
Programs
- Building a Healthy Neighborhood: This program involves a multiyear commitment to a target neighborhood, working in partnership with residents and community stakeholders to improve the health and safety of homes and community infrastructure.
- Safe at Home: Focuses on identifying and addressing home hazards, conducting repairs such as roof replacements and ADA bathroom modifications to improve accessibility and safety.
- Veterans at Home: Provides no-cost home modifications and repairs for veterans and their families, enhancing safety and accessibility.
- Disaster [Re]Pairs and [Re]Siliency: Offers disaster mitigation, preparedness, and recovery support to help communities rebuild after natural disasters.

Funding and Volunteer Engagement
The organization is funded by a variety of sources, including corporate sponsors, individual donors, and government entities. Volunteers are central to their operations, and no prior construction skills are required for participation in their projects.
